Microfiche Cataloging Instructions

1. Locate correct OCLC record. Make any cataloging changes needed, and download into ALEPH.
2. In ALEPH, add the call number: 099 [blank][blank] _
Currently, call numbers can be found in the “Red Book” marked Microforms, CD-Roms, DVD-ROMS Numbers kept at Lucy deGozzaldi's desk. (this will likely change). Use the numbers in section: Microfiche Main. Assign monographs and serials numbers from this list.
For an example see: ALEPH bib: 15091099 (Title: Rule ordering in syntax)
3. Add 910 data to the bibliographic record, as needed.
4. Create an item record for the piece using the following codes:
Sublibrary: UMDUB
Collection: UMMFF
Material type: MICR
ITEM STATUS: 20
ITEM PROCESS STATUS: [blank] not PC*
5. Create a HOL record. Format as follows:
852 8 [blank]
[subfield]b UMDUB
[subfield]c UMMFF
[subfield]h[number assigned to piece in 099 in bib record]
Add:
856 48 [subfield]u http://library.umass.edu/microform-retrieval-request/
[subfield]z Request Microform
6. Write call number on microfiche sleeve, or arrange for End Processing to type labels.
7. Give to End Processing for ownership stamp.
*Note: with no Item Process Status code to change or delete, End Processing can now pass the microfiche to Circulation directly.
